The red wine Blaufränkisch, vintage 2013 from the winery Weingut Ipsmiller has been rated in 2017 by Peter Moser with 89 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Blaufränkisch from the region Weinviertel in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Dark ruby garnet, violet reflections, delicate edge brightening. Herbal-spicy nuances of dried plums, candied oranges. Delicately vegetal, subtle fruit sweetness, somewhat wide-meshed texture, chocolatey touch on the finish, offers uncomplicated drinking pleasure.
